Abstract
The utility model discloses a kind of efficiently dry method powder screening device, including supporting rack, fixed frame is connected with the right side of supporting rack upper end, fixed frame upper end is connected with L-type mounting bracket, fixed column is installed on the inside of L-type mounting bracket upper end, fixed column lower end is connected with fixed ball, fixed ball is internally provided with cavity, uniformly discharge pipe is connected with the outside of cavity, cavity upper end connects having heaters by air hose, heater is connected with air-introduced machine, fixed frame lower end is hinged with oscillating deck, oscillating deck upper center is connected with screening frame, screening outer frame wall is uniformly provided with screening hole, upper end is connected with eccentric wheel on the right side of supporting rack, eccentric wheel upper end is hinged with locking bar.The utility model, not only realize the high frequency zone to powder, also the coarse dispersion after screening is ground at the same time, the progress of later stage process is further speeded up, at the same time by equipped with cavity and air-introduced machine also the powder screened is dried, so that convection current collision occurs for powder, the screening efficiency to powder is greatly accelerated.

Background technology
In the preparation and application of powder, it is often necessary to graded operation is carried out to powder, to meet certain powder technique
Need.The common device of graded operation is exactly screening plant, and screening plant mainly has:Vibrating screen, shaker screen, roto-siofter, fixation
Sieve.And granular material is sieved, the methods for using vibrosieve, but vibrating screen is for the powder, super of relatively fine particle. more
When fine powder body is sieved, putty often occurs and influences the continuity and reliability of screening operation, and sieve is being subject to
During the gravity of material, mesh size can become larger or diminish, so as to influence screening precision.
Chinese patent(Notification number:206061818U)Disclose a kind of dry sieving device for powder material, including feed inlet
With screening chamber, although the device adds the screening quality to powder to a certain extent, which is actually being sieving through
Cheng Zhong, coarse dispersion are only to screen, and are become small powder without being ground again, this drastically influence the later stage
Manufacturing procedure.

A kind of efficiently dry method powder screening device, during work, first by the powder material for needing to sieve by feeding intake
Bucket 5 be incorporated into screening frame 2 in, afterwards start electric rotating machine 15, electric rotating machine 15 drive screening frame 2 rotate synchronously, then from
Under the action of mental and physical efforts, the powder sieved in frame 2 is sieved, fine powder material is sized out by sieving in hole 12, and coarse powder material
Then continue to stay in screening frame 2, coarse dispersion be ground under the interaction between tooth lapping 13, then proceedes to sieve,
Until the screening of all powders is finished, staff removes locking bar 17 from 8 right end of L-type mounting bracket afterwards, rotation eccentric wheel 16,
14 right end of oscillating deck is rotated clockwise along fixed frame 3, incites somebody to action and exports powder, easy to operate, reliability is high.This practicality is new
Type, it is rational in infrastructure, it is novel in design, by equipped with sieve powder frame 2 and fixed ball 6 between mutual cooperation, not only realize to powder
The high frequency zone of body, while also the coarse dispersion after screening is ground, the progress of later stage process has been further speeded up, has been led at the same time
Cross the cavity 61 being equipped with and air-introduced machine 11 is also dried the powder screened so that convection current collision occurs for powder, significantly
The screening efficiency to powder is accelerated, it is highly practical.
